The Medical Director for Operations, Governance, & Digital at GE Healthcare leads the operational backbone of Medical Affairs in the US and Canada, ensuring compliant and efficient execution of medical strategies. This role focuses on operational excellence, cross-functional coordination, and audit readiness, managing a team and partnering with various departments to support safe and ethical medical engagement.

What you'd actually do

  1. Lead US/CAN Medical Operations strategy aligned with GMA global frameworks, PDx priorities, and US/CAN Medical Affairs strategic plans.
  2. Drive operational planning cycles (annual plans, OKRs, operating rhythms) including medical activity tracking, dashboards, KPIs, and compliance documentation.
  3. Translate scientific and medical priorities into executable operational processes, systems, and workflows.
  4. Partner with US/CAN Medical leadership to ensure operational resourcing, budget planning, forecasting, vendor oversight, and contracting compliance.
  5. Contribute to operational design of US/CAN medical launch readiness, evidence initiatives, field excellence activities, and cross‑functional accountability planning.
